package java.io;

/**
 * Signals a problem during the serialization or or deserialization of an
 * object. Possible reasons include:
 * 
    *
  • The SUIDs of the class loaded by the VM and the serialized class info do * not match.
  • *
  • A serializable or externalizable object cannot be instantiated (when * deserializing) because the no-arg constructor that needs to be run is not * visible or fails.
  • *
* * @see ObjectInputStream #readObject() * @see ObjectInputValidation#validateObject() */ public class InvalidClassException extends ObjectStreamException { private static final long serialVersionUID = -4333316296251054416L; /** * The fully qualified name of the class that caused the problem. */ public String classname; /** * Constructs a new {@code InvalidClassException} with its stack trace and * detailed message filled in. * * @param detailMessage * the detail message for this exception. */ public InvalidClassException(String detailMessage) { super(detailMessage); } /** * Constructs a new {@code InvalidClassException} with its stack trace, * detail message and the fully qualified name of the class which caused the * exception filled in. * * @param className * the name of the class that caused the exception. * @param detailMessage * the detail message for this exception. */ public InvalidClassException(String className, String detailMessage) { super(detailMessage); this.classname = className; } /** * Returns the detail message which was provided when the exception was * created. {@code null} is returned if no message was provided at creation * time. If a detail message as well as a class name are provided, then the * values are concatenated and returned. * * @return the detail message, possibly concatenated with the name of the * class that caused the problem. */ @Override public String getMessage() { String msg = super.getMessage(); if (classname != null) { msg = classname + "; " + msg; } return msg; } }
